Labels matter 

Image courtesy of the NSLC.

Luckily, it’s often easy to tell the difference between legal and illicit cannabis based on the packaging alone. This is one of the times you can—and should—judge a book by the cover! Regulated cannabis will always have the following features to set it apart: 

Cannabis purchased on the grey market has none of the safeguards the NSLC provides.

  • Standardized cannabis symbol.
  • Health warning in English and French.
  • Province excise stamp.
  • Recommended amount for use.
  • THC, CBD, and other cannabinoid content.
  • Ingredients and nutrition information.

Related

Cannabis laws and regulations in Nova Scotia

If any of those elements are missing from the packaging, you’re likely dealing with cannabis you can’t fully trust. Likewise, there are a few tell-tale features that you can use to spot illicit cannabis. Beware of:

  • Colourful, flashy packaging.
  • Branding reminiscent of popular candies or snacks.
  • Images of celebrities or pop culture figures.
  • Edibles containing more than 10mg THC.

If you spot cannabis with any of these warning signs, make sure you pass, don’t puff.
